People & Context
Jesus Christ
Lifts His eyes to heaven and prays the High Priestly Prayer for Himself, His disciples, and all believers.
God the Father
The Holy and Righteous Father whom Jesus addresses, asking Him to glorify the Son and keep the disciples.
Timeline
The High Priestly Prayer
Jesus prays to the Father to be glorified, and intercedes for the protection, sanctification, and unity of His disciples.
